Page 1

ILA is a line array system designed specifically
for installation in a variety of venues including
houses of worship, sports facilities, clubs
and other entertainment venues. ILA System
v2 is a complete system consisting of line
array, subwoofer, processing, amplification
and suspension accessories. The result is an
accessible system with very high performance,
moderate cost and ease of deployment.

Most line array systems currently available
are designed for touring applications, which
require extreme ruggedization and expensive
suspension hardware. As a result, overall
system cost is driven beyond the means of
many facilities that could benefit from line
array performance. By focusing on installation
applications, using a molded enclosure and
simplifying the rigging design, QSC has driven
cost out of the ILA System while retaining the
sound quality, coverage and power of high end
touring line array systems.

WL2082-i

Each Installation Line Array element uses a
pair of high-power, neodymium magnet, 8"
diameter low-frequency drivers. Both woofers
produce low frequencies but only one covers
the mid-range resulting in more uniform
directivity in the crossover region. For high

frequencies, a pair of 1.75" (voice coil diameter)
neodymium compression drivers with titanium
domes are mounted on a multiple aperture
diffraction waveguide* that provides extremely
wide coverage (140º). As a result, a WL2082-i
system will rarely require additional side or
center fill speakers and solid stereo imaging is
preserved across the listening area.

The system may be used in bi-amplified or
tri-amplified mode. In general, the tri-amplified
mode will produce the best performance and,
for arrays larger than four boxes, will not
increase the total cost of system amplification.

Available in black or white, the WL2082-i
enclosure is made of high impact polystyrene
with extensive internal ribs to eliminate acoustic
losses due to sidewall flex. The Installation Line
Array may be used in outdoor applications
where the system is not directly exposed
to the elements. The enclosure material is
formulated with UV inhibitors, the grille is
made of aluminum and the woofer cones are
weather resistant.

Rigging

Rigging for the ILA is simple, flexible and safe
providing a 10:1 design factor with twelve
WL2082-i systems in the array (see the owner’s

manual for details before planning any array
suspension). The array is assembled with the
included bolts and the relative angle between
adjacent boxes is adjustable in 1º increments
for precise tailoring of vertical coverage. For
those who prefer quick release pins to the
included bolts, an optional kit of four quick
release pins (QRP-KIT-1) is available.

Subwoofer

The subwoofer for ILA System v2 is the
WL118-sw, a single 18" version of the popular
WideLine-10 touring, dual 18" subwoofer and
offers an impressive combination of punch
and low-frequency extension. ILA subs may
be suspended at the top of an ILA array using
the standard FP2082-i array frame. When trim
height is limited, the ILA sub may be suspended
behind the array using the available EB2082-i
extension bar.

Features of the WL2082-i

• Installation-optimized design brings affordable and

uncompromised line array performance to a broader range

of venues

• Compact and attractive appearance, available in black and white,

harmonizes with any installation environment

• Wide 140° horizontal coverage

• Economical and easy-to-install suspension system with ample

array adjustability

Features of the WL118-sw

• Single 18

" subwoofer in a bass-reflex enclosure

• 850 watt continuous power capacity

• Frequency range down to 29 Hz

• May be suspended at the top, or behind the WL2082-i array

• Available in black or white to harmonize with venue décor
